Walk You Home
Photo by Patrick Tomasso on Unsplash

Where are you?

Wondering the streets

3 AM,

and you called me

It's no bother, baby

keep your nose clean

To keep her happy

Remove every trace of me

Out of One Hundred contacts in your phone

You called me,

and I walked you home

I wish you were not so heartbreak prone

I always wanna walk you home

I found you

Stood on the streets

4 AM,

and you held me

It's no trouble, baby

It's just time for us to leave

To keep her happy

Don't tell her you called me

Out of One Hundred contacts in your phone

You called me, and I walked you home

I wish you were not so heartbreak prone

I always wanna walk you home
